Originality
I looked at the moon and
felt its perfection
But that had already been said
In a book.
I looked at the sky and felt
Unknowable hugeness in a wide expanse of blue
But that had already been said
In a book.
I looked at myself
And felt my song running pale and shallow
But strong.
But that had already been said
In a poem.
I looked at You, Christ,
And felt and saw more than I
Can hold, and though it has
Already been said in a Book,
I feel and know it newer and truer
Than all else.
